Common Pitfalls: What to Avoid
On your journey to embrace this modern approach, there are definitely pitfalls. Here are a few:
Ignoring Local Context: Just because you can optimize for “HVAC repair” doesn’t mean it’ll work. Think local—neighborhood by neighborhood. Use terms that your specific audience in Houston resonates with.
Falling for Gimmicks: Not every AI tool is created equal. Some might promise you the moon but deliver crumby results. Do your homework. Read reviews, ask for testimonials.
Neglecting Follow-Up: You can generate leads, but they need nurturing. Automate follow-ups to keep potential leads engaged and guide them down your sales funnel. Otherwise, those leads are just going to fade.
Building a Framework
So, what does a solid AI SEO strategy look like for an HVAC business? Here’s a rough blueprint that can adapt based on your unique situation:
Keyword Research: Tools like Ahrefs or SEMrush can provide a goldmine of information. Focus not only on primary keywords but also long-tail keywords that reflect local specificity.
Content Creation: Create content that answers your audience’s questions. Don’t just push sell; educate. Blog posts about seasonal HVAC maintenance tips or energy-saving hacks can position you as a trusted authority.
On-Page Optimization: Ensure your site loads quickly, is mobile-friendly, and that you’re using meta tags wisely. This is where that AI magic comes into play, helping you analyze what’s effective.
Local Listings: Make sure your business is listed efficiently on Google My Business, Yelp, and any relevant local directories. Consistency is key here. An inconsistent name, address, or phone number is a red flag for search engines.
Link Building: Cultivate relationships with local relevance—get featured in local news, collaborate with community blogs, or join Houston-specific business associations. Backlinks from reputable sources really boost your standing.

FAQs
Q: Can small businesses handle SEO themselves?
A: Yes, absolutely. But consistency is where many fail. People often quit before they’ve given SEO enough time to show results.
Q: How long until I see results from these strategies?
A: It varies, but typically you’re looking at a few months. SEO isn’t instant; it’s a long play.
Q: What if I don’t have a huge budget for these tools?
A: You can start with free or low-cost SEO tools and gradually invest as you see results. Don’t feel pressured to spend big right out of the gate.
